Grand Founding Festival of the Volunteer Fire Brigade Rechtmehring-Rosenberg
The Volunteer Fire Brigade Rechtmehring-Rosenberg e.V. was founded in 1876 and is celebrating its 150th anniversary in 2026. Rechtmehring is located in the district of Mühldorf am Inn, in the state of Bavaria, between Wasserburg am Inn and Haag in Upper Bavaria. Already at the 75th anniversary in 1959, the fire brigade marched through the town with 60 patron clubs – an impressive testament to the FFW's roots in the region.
From June 25th to 29th, 2026, the large festival tent will be erected on the festival grounds at the edge of the village. The festival opens on Thursday evening with the traditional Bieranstich (beer tapping), followed by festival evenings with live music from Lower and Upper Bavaria. The highlight, as experience shows, is the Festival Sunday with a church procession, festival mass, parade of the patron clubs, and a grand parade through Rechtmehring and Rosenberg.
On such an anniversary, the patron fire brigades from the surrounding communities play a central role. Preparations are already underway a year in advance with photo sessions of active and passive members in uniform, handover of new sets of uniforms, and information evenings in the 'Genussstuben' (enjoyment rooms) at the Kirchenwirt (church inn). In particular, the anniversary publication, the club chronicle, and the festival newspaper are created by a specially formed festival committee.
Beer from a local brewery will be served in the festival tent, along with Lower Bavarian delicacies: roast pork, dumplings, sausages from the grill, and salads. The evenings are hosted by various live bands; on youth night, party bands take over the program, and on festival Sunday, traditionally a festival band.
The 150th founding festival of the FFW Rechtmehring-Rosenberg will take place from June 25th to 29th, 2026. The entry in the event calendar of the municipality of Rechtmehring confirms the five-day festival week. It kicks off on Thursday evening with the beer tapping, Friday features the youth evening, Saturday the festival evening with a festival band, and Sunday the highlight with the festival mass and grand parade. Monday marks the cozy end of the festival.
Free admission. Food and drinks are sold in the festival tent at club-standard festival prices (liter mug of beer, roast pork, sausage).
Rechtmehring is located about 12 km north of Wasserburg am Inn on Staatsstraße 2089. Regional buses run from Wasserburg am Inn train station towards Haag. Parking is available at the festival grounds and in the town center.
Free admission to the festival grounds and the festival tent. Food and drinks are available at club-standard prices, festival beer, and Lower Bavarian dishes.
Sunday, June 28th, for the festival mass and the grand parade of the patron clubs; Saturday evening for the festival evening with a live band.
